The invention belongs to the technical field of elevators, and particularly provides an elevator control method based on edge calculation, intelligent equipment and an elevator system. The invention aims to solve the problem of how to obtain a user elevator taking scene and carry out elevator control based on the user elevator taking scene. In order to achieve the purpose, the method comprises the steps that personnel information of each elevator taking person and article information of preset articles are obtained based on an image of an elevator waiting area, then a user elevator taking scene corresponding to the elevator taking person is determined, and an elevator dispatching strategy is adjusted according to the user elevator taking scene. And when the elevator taking scene of the user is the time priority scene, the scheduling strategy that the elevator operation time is shortest is adopted, so that the elevator taking person can reach the target floor at the fastest speed, and the requirements of special scenes such as medical assistance and emergency rescue are met. And when the elevator taking scene of the user is the distance priority scene, the elevator closest to the elevator taking person is selected as the response elevator of the elevator taking request, so that the heavy object carrying or walking distance of the elevator taking person is reduced, and the user experience is improved.
